About Richmond House

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

Richmond House is a six-bedroom detached house in Denstone, Uttoxeter, Uttoxeter (ST14 5HR). It has a recorded floor area of 218 m² (around 2347 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1900-1929 and council tax band F. The latest certificate (August 2021) shows a D (score 56), a step below the typical UK home. When first surveyed in August 2009 the rating was F, the property has climbed 2 bands since. Between certificates, roof efficiency went from Very Poor to Very Good, hot-water efficiency went from Poor to Average and lighting went from Good to Very Good.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 85), a 2-band jump. Main heating runs on oil. Period features are noted in the property record. Records show the property has been extended at some point in its history.

Untraded for 17 years, with the last transfer in November 2009. That sale fell during the post-crash dip, which often skews comparisons against later neighbouring sales. At 218 m² the property is well over the postcode median (123 m² across 15 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ock. 6 bedrooms is on the larger side for this postcode, where 4 is the typical count. One planning record on file: an extension approved in 2007. Past consents include an extension,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. Today's modelled estimate of £754,000 is 37.1% above the 2009 sale price.
